Cysboard: sistemski monitor zasnovan na html-u i css-u

Cysboard

Cysboard

u oni koji već poznaju Conky, znat će prednosti ovog alata koji nam omogućuje nadgledanje našeg sustava uz plus modificiranja njegovog vizualnog izgleda dajući personalizirani izgled našoj radnoj površini.

Surfajući malo po mreži, naišao sam na alternativu Conkyju. Dobro onda, Reći ću vam malo o Cysbordu, jednostavnom, laganom i moćnom alatu za nadzor.

Cysboard je sustav za nadzor otvorenog koda sličan Conkyu, program je napisao na C ++, HTML i CSS programer Michael Osei ovo koristite HTML i CSS kako biste svojim temama dali vizualni stil.

Cysboard dobiva podatke iz našeg sustava, uzimajući operativni sustav koji koristimo, koliko RAM-a imamo, procesor, našu IP adresu i još mnogo toga.

Kako instalirati Cysboard na Ubuntu?

Da biste instalirali aplikaciju u naš sustav, morat ćemo klonirati git ovoga i sastaviti kod iz našeg tima.

Da bismo izvršili ovaj zadatak, moramo imati instalirane potrebne ovisnosti, a to su cmake i gcc.

Da bismo klonirali git i instalirali Cysboard, radimo to pomoću ovih naredbi:

git clone https://github.com/mike168m/Cysboard.git
cd Cysboard/
mkdir build
cmake
make 

Ovim smo već instalirali aplikaciju u naš sustav možemo stvoriti vlastite teme za cysboard Moramo slijediti upute programera:

  • Stvorite datoteku za temu, nazvat ćemo je main.html unutar ~ / .config / cysboard /.
  • Dodajte HTML kôd s bilo kojim identifikatorima navedenim u tablici koja se nalazi u githubu koji pruža informacije o sustavu.
  • Pokreni cysboard.

Tablica identifikatora za stvaranje tema je sljedeća:

ID Informacija
cpu_name Naziv CPU-a
korištenje CPU-a Ukupna potrošnja procesora u postocima
cpu_arch CPU arhitektura
cpu_dobavljač Na primjer, dobavljač procesora. Intel, AMD
cpu_broj_ jezgri Broj procesorskih jezgri
mem_free Količina slobodne memorije u KB, MB ili GB
mem_use Količina memorije koja se koristi u KB, MB ili GB
mem_swap_total Količina zamjenske memorije u KB, MB ili GB
mem_ukupno Ukupna dostupna fizička memorija
ime_os Naziv operativnog sustava
os_distro_name Koju distribuciju koristimo
os_uptime Ukupno vrijeme proteklo od zadnjeg pokretanja
os_broj_procs Koliko procesa pokrećemo?
exec_ # Pokrenite program i prikažite njegov izlaz, npr. Exec_0, exec_1 itd.
korištenje CPU-a_ # Primjerice, utvrdite postotak upotrebe CPU jezgre. CPU_usage_0, CPU_usage_1 itd

U svakom slučaju, aplikacija dolazi sa zadanom temom s kojom možemo vidjeti što nam aplikacija nudi u sustavu.


Ostavite svoj komentar

Vaša email adresa neće biti objavljen. Obavezna polja su označena s *

*

*

  1. Za podatke odgovoran: Miguel Ángel Gatón
  2. Svrha podataka: Kontrola neželjene pošte, upravljanje komentarima.
  3. Legitimacija: Vaš pristanak
  4. Komunikacija podataka: Podaci se neće dostavljati trećim stranama, osim po zakonskoj obvezi.
  5. Pohrana podataka: Baza podataka koju hostira Occentus Networks (EU)
  6. Prava: U bilo kojem trenutku možete ograničiti, oporaviti i izbrisati svoje podatke.

  1.   Jimmy olano dijo

    Iako razvijam softver na nekoliko jezika, nisam imao instaliran «cmake», jer već znate:

    sudo apt-get instaliraj cmake

  2.   Jimmy olano dijo

    Također nemam "gtk + -3.0" (koristim Ubuntu 16.04); pa naprijed:

    sudo apt-get install gtk + -3.0